Hobs with induction
Induction hobs use magnetism instead of direct heat to warm pans and pots. Under the cooktop surface are coils through which an alternating electric current is run. When a ferromagnetic pot or pan is placed on the cooktop this creates a magnetic field which generates electricity. The cooktop is also cool to touch and is energy efficient as compared to gas or electric models.
Induction hobs have another advantage: they are safer than gas hobs made of traditional materials. There is no open flame that can harm your hands or cookware. They are ideal for student residences and iQ Student Accommodation flats where security is a top priority. This kind of stove is also easy to clean since the smooth glass-ceramic cooktop surface isn't hot and can be easily cleaned with a damp cloth.
Induction requires special pans. You'll require pans that have a flat, even thick base made of ferrous metals like cast iron or steel. To determine if these pans will be induction-compatible, you should apply a magnet to the base. If the magnet is stuck to the pan, it's suitable for your induction cooker.

Gas hobs
Gas hobs utilize propane or natural gas to heat their burners and oven hob. This allows for a faster cooking time and better temperature control. This makes it ideal for frying, boiling and sauteing as well as for other cooking techniques. While it may not be as energy-efficient as an electric hob, a gas one is generally cheaper to operate than one powered by electricity.
Additionally the gas hob's heat source is not dependent on electricity, so it can still function in the event of power interruptions, though at a lower rate. The heat produced by the burners is also confined to the pans that they come into contact with, decreasing the risk of fire. To avoid fires, it's important to keep flammable items away from the flames.
Modern gas hobs consist of traditional burners and electrical components that regulate ignition, flame output and safety features. Most models use an electric ignition system that emits either an electric spark or pilot flame to ignite the burner. The control knobs let you alter the intensity of the flame as well as the heat output. Many include a built-in timer, Oven Hob which allows you to set a specific cooking time.
Gas hobs are usually cheaper to purchase upfront than models with induction, however the cost of running them will depend on the local gas prices. Certain gas hobs can be used with li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) which is less expensive than natural gas.
Gas hobs need more attention than electric ones. The burner grates are prone to attract grease-based spills and you'll need to wipe down the flat rimless cooking surface more frequently to prevent food debris from becoming lodged in crevices. Electric hobs
Electric hobs heat quickly and are easy to clean. They utilize electric coils that produce heat below the cooking area. Many models come with residual heat indicators that tell you what zones were used recently and are too hot to touch or clean. This is particularly useful in homes with children. Some models also come with an overflow safety feature that detects when a pot is boiling over and immediately shuts off the stove to stop spills from happening.
